Pillows for Pregnancy: Comfort and Support for Expecting Mothers Pregnancy brings many physical changes, and one of the most challenging aspects for many expecting mothers is finding a comfortable position to sleep and relax as their bodies evolve. Pregnancy pillowsare specially designed to provide comfort and support during this time, addressing the unique needs of women as their bodies undergo significant changes. Here’s an in-depth look at how pregnancy pillows can make a big difference in providing relief, comfort, and support during pregnancy.
1. Enhanced Comfort and Restful Sleep • As pregnancy progresses, physical discomfort—especially during sleep—can become more pronounced due to back pain, leg cramps, heartburn, and difficulty finding a comfortable sleeping position. Pregnancy pillows are designed to alleviate these issues by offering targeted support to key areas of the body. • Support for the Back: A growing belly puts extra pressure on the lower back. Pregnancy pillows, particularly full-body pillows, help relieve this pressure by offering extra cushioning and support along the back, helping to reduce aches and promote better alignment. • Side Sleeping Support: Doctors often recommend sleeping on the left side during pregnancy to improve blood circulation to both the baby and the mother. A pregnancy pillow can help maintain this position by propping up the body, preventing discomfort during the night. • 2. Relieving Pressure on the Belly • As the baby grows, the weight of the belly can put strain on the abdominal muscles, especially when lying flat on the back or on the stomach (which becomes increasingly difficult). Pregnancy pillows are designed to support the belly without putting added pressure on it. • Support for the Abdomen: Certain pregnancy pillows have a cut-out design to cradle the belly, offering gentle support that helps relieve strain. • Reducing Ligament Pain: The weight of the growing baby can cause round ligament pain, a sharp, sudden discomfort on one or both sides of the lower abdomen. Pillows help redistribute weight and relieve this pressure.

Improving Circulation and Reducing Swelling • Pregnant women often experience swollen feet, ankles, and legs due to the increased fluid retention and the pressure exerted by the uterus on blood vessels. Pregnancy pillows can help improve circulation and reduce swelling by elevating the legs and supporting the lower body. • Elevating the Legs: A wedge-shaped pillow or a pillow between the knees can elevate the legs slightly, improving circulation and reducing fluid buildup. • Improved Blood Flow: By encouraging side sleeping and reducing pressure on blood vessels, pregnancy pillows help promote better blood flow throughout the body, especially to the heart and the baby. • 4. Providing Support for Hips, Knees, and Pelvis • Pregnancy often causes discomfort in the hips and pelvic area as the body prepares for childbirth. The hips and pelvis can experience alignment issues due to the extra weight in the front of the body. A pregnancy pillow provides the necessary support to keep the hips in alignment and reduce pain in these areas. • Knee Support: A pregnancy pillow between the knees helps align the hips and reduces strain on the lower back, which can alleviate pelvic pain and hip discomfort. • Pelvic Support: Pregnancy pillows can provide support that stabilizes the pelvis and prevents misalignment that could contribute to discomfort or pain during sleep. • 5. Reducing Heartburn and Acid Reflux • As pregnancy hormones and the growing uterus push up against the stomach, many women experience heartburn and acid reflux. Sleeping in a slightly elevated position can help alleviate these symptoms, and pregnancy pillows can help maintain that position comfortably. • Head and Upper Body Elevation: A wedge pillow or a body pillow can help elevate the upper body slightly, reducing the likelihood of stomach acid rising into the esophagus, and providing relief from heartburn and indigestion.

Types of Pregnancy Pillows • There are various types of pregnancy pillows to meet the specific needs and preferences of different mothers: • Full-Body Pillows: These pillows are long and provide support along the entire body. They help with side sleeping and offer support to the belly, back, and legs, making them perfect for full-body comfort. • U-Shaped Pillows: These pillows are ideal for those who like to have extra support for both sides of their body. They cradle the entire body from head to toe, providing support to the back, belly, and legs simultaneously. • C-Shaped Pillows: Similar to U-shaped pillows but with one open end, these pillows provide support to the back and belly, with the open side allowing space for the legs to stretch out. • Wedge Pillows: Smaller than full-body pillows, wedge pillows are typically used for supporting the belly or elevating the legs, and can be placed under the lower back or between the knees. • Back Support Pillows: These pillows are specifically designed to support the back or lumbar region and are often used in conjunction with other types of pregnancy pillows for added relief.
